Understanding Feng Shui in Your Garden
Feng Shui, an ancient Chinese practice, emphasizes the importance of harmonizing individuals with their environment. In your garden, this means creating an inviting space that fosters tranquility and positivity. By integrating specific feng shui elements, you can enhance the energy flow, making your outdoor area a true extension of your home. This practice not only beautifies your surroundings but also nurtures emotional well-being, promoting a sense of peace and balance.
The Power of Water Features
Water is a vital feng shui element, symbolizing abundance and prosperity. Incorporating a water feature, such as a fountain or pond, can significantly enhance the positive energy in your garden. The gentle sound of flowing water creates a soothing atmosphere that encourages relaxation and reflection. Position your water feature in the right area—ideally, the southeast corner of your garden—to maximize its benefits. Regular maintenance is crucial to keep the water clear and flowing, which helps maintain the positive energy.

Colors and plants play a critical role in feng shui. Choose vibrant, healthy plants that resonate with your desired energy. For instance, red flowers symbolize passion and vitality, while green plants promote growth and healing. Additionally, consider the layout of your garden; a balanced arrangement of plants can create a sense of harmony. Avoid overcrowding, as this can lead to chaotic energy. Instead, opt for a mix of heights and textures to foster a sense of movement and flow throughout the space.

Natural materials, such as stone, wood, and bamboo, can significantly enhance your garden’s feng shui. These elements connect your space to nature, fostering a sense of grounding and stability. Incorporate wooden benches or stone pathways to create a harmonious flow throughout the garden. Furthermore, using rounded stones can soften sharp edges, promoting gentle energy flow. Remember, the key is to maintain balance; too many hard materials can create a harsh environment.

Lighting is essential in feng shui as it influences the energy of your space. Utilize soft, warm lighting to create a welcoming atmosphere. Solar-powered garden lights or lanterns can illuminate pathways and highlight focal points, enhancing the garden’s overall appeal. Consider placing lights near your water feature or seating areas to encourage gathering and connection. Avoid harsh, bright lights, as they can create an unsettling environment and disrupt the garden’s tranquility.

Regular maintenance is vital to uphold the positive energy in your garden. A well-tended space reflects care and attention, which resonates with positive vibes. Dedicate time to pruning, watering, and cleaning your garden, ensuring it remains a peaceful retreat. Additionally, practice mindfulness while tending to your garden. Engaging fully in the process allows you to connect with the energy of the space, fostering a deeper appreciation for its beauty and tranquility.
